Job Description

Clinical Services Assistant Manager leading a team of clinical experts for Claims operations. Overseeing clinical services, driving process improvements, and promoting clinical resources within the organization.

Responsibilities:

  • Lead daily clinical services operations including nurse case management, pharmacy, nurse review, and bill review functions.
  • Evaluate referrals and claim complexity, assigning work to internal staff or vendor partners.
  • Manage team workload, priorities, turnaround times, and overall service delivery.
  • Ensure clinical services are effectively integrated into claims handling processes and partner closely with claim professionals.
  • Lead, coach, develop, and monitor the performance of the Clinical Services team.
  • Oversee operational reporting, recommend KPIs, and monitor vendor performance and outcomes.
  • Partner with Claims leadership to expand clinical services, improve consultation practices, and enhance service quality.
  • Support implementation of new tools, clinical programs, regulatory changes, and vendor solutions.
  • Identify training needs, develop educational programs, and promote clinical services throughout the organization.
  • Drive process improvement initiatives that enhance efficiency, quality, and claim outcomes.

Requirements:

  • Current Registered Nurse (RN) license
  • Bachelor’s degree in nursing (BSN) preferred
  • Eight years of nursing experience including at least four years of property and casualty clinical claim oversight
  • Legal Nurse Consultant Certified (LNCC) designation, Case Management (CM), or other applicable designations preferred
  • Experience in multiple medical specialties preferred
  • Previous leadership or supervisory experience preferred
